Product Description

Product Description

At the core of this book is an extended photographic storyboard that follows the stages of creating a tropical freshwater aquarium. From day one to week twelve and beyond, this real time practical sequence provides a unique insight into the successes and setbacks of turning an empty glass box into a thriving underwater world. At logical points along this timeline of practical progress, profile sections feature selections of aquarium plants and fish. The emphasis is on explaining the natural cycles involved and stressing that successful fishkeeping demands care, compassion, creativity and technical expertise. The ideal hobby, in fact.

About the Author

Stuart Thraves has had a lifelong fascination with fish. This led him to study them at Sparsholt College in Hampshire, England. Stuart s interest in fish has also developed into a favourite hobby diving which he enjoys pursuing around the UK and in the Red Sea. Today, he is Brand Manager of a leading aquarist supply company. His day-to-day experience of the hobby keeps him abreast of the latest developments and provides an ideal platform for writing this book.

This book is not cheap, even at Amazon prices but it is worth the extra few pounds. The author has been involved in the writing or co-writing of a number of aquarium/tropical fish books and has certainly got the hang of how to go about producing a good book, covering all aspects of fish-keeping.

The book takes you step by step through the business of setting up an aquarium, something that you must know how to do correctly, because if you don't the results can be catastrophic. Most people when they get a tank, immediately want to see some fish in it. Disaster strikes and they give up the idea of keeping fish before they have even started.

This book tell you the correct way to set up the tank when to introduce the plant and more importantly when to put fish in. Without going into great detail here, a chemical process needs to take place before the water is fit to put fish in. Putting fish into water that five minutes ago was in the tap is a sure recipe for disaster. The book explains what needs to be done step by step.

Follow the instructions in the book and you will have a wonderful looking tank with beautiful, healthy fish, some of which are shown in the excellent photographs in the book. The old saying "it's easy when you know how" illustrates why you should buy this book and anyway watching the movements of brightly colored fish , that rapidly become tame enough show their hungry when you get the food out is much better than watching TV and more relaxing.

I am a total novice when it comes to Aquariums, just about to make my own from scratch (thats siliconing the thing together as well!).

This book arrived the other day via Amazon's usual, (to date) faultless service, and I have read it front to back already.

Well set out and highly informative, especially aimed at the beginner but I feel sure the more advanced fishkeeper will find it helpful too.
Step by step setting up of the equipment detailing the alternatives available along the way.
Comprehensive section on aquatic plants.
Separate sections detailing first fish to buy, then second and then a selection of fish to be added when the tank is more established. Concentrates on the community fish but includes a selection of Cichlids suitable for the comunity tank.
One extra plus, is its indication of the size of each fish fully grown, something many books fail to do.

You can't go wrong with this book, worth every penny.
